For 56 years, Michael Thomas Steele has been waiting for this day.
His world was turned upside down on April 16.
He learned that he had a sister that he never knew about.
Kelly Prock sent Steele a letter from Elgin, S.C., where she resides.
Through the website, Ancestry.com, Prock found Steele’s address and stated that they were related.
She revealed various facts about him and his parents to prove that she was for real.
“Kelly couldn’t believe that she had a brother for all of this time,” Steele said. “When I got halfway through the letter, and saw my mother’s name, I started to cry. I was so overwhelmed, and I didn’t know how to contain myself. It was so amazing because they had been looking for me for a long time.”
Mary McGuire had Steele when she and his father, Harry Steele, were both 19 years old.
They were married at the time of his birth, but separated shortly afterwards.
After a car accident, McGuire spent months in the hospital.
It was then that Steele’s grandmother decided that he should live with other relatives in Wisconsin.
Eventually his father picked him up, and he lived with his father until he became an adult.
McGuire never knew about this, and expressed her anger about the subject when she learned about it.
“She was heartbroken,” Prock said in the letter. “She sent you letters and gifts for years, but they were all rejected and returned to her. She never stopped wondering where you were or loving you. We have both been trying to find you for a long time.”
McGuire eventually remarried, and gave birth to Prock.
It wasn’t until a few weeks ago that Steele spoke to his mother for the first time.
She lives in Tupper Lake, N.Y. these days, but Steele keeps in contact with her at least once a week whether it’s through phone or email.
“I just talked to my mom on Wednesday,” he said. “We were on the phone for about 15 to 20 minutes. It was mostly me just asking more questions. She’s sending me some more information about my family that should get here around Tuesday. I just feel so blessed.”
